WebIf this is not practical, minimum mulch circle radii should be 3 feet for small trees, 8 feet for medium trees, and 12 feet for large trees. Figure 1. WebStaking is often unnecessary. Occasionally, newly planted trees may require staking when: They have unusually small root systems that can’t physically support the larger, above-ground growth (stem and leaves). The stem bends excessively when not supported. The planting site is very windy and trees will be uprooted if they are not supported. Web26 de out. de 2024 · 7-8 inches: 5 – 7 foot trees.
